We are seeking an enthusiastic and detail-oriented Asst Color & Print Designer to join our dynamic team. This role involves coordinating and executing brand-right color and print designs that align with our seasonal concepts and business strategies.
Responsibilities
- Develop and style brand-right color and print stories that tie back to seasonal concepts and fabric programs.
- Partner with design teams to build prints and novelty raw materials that complement the overall product assortment.
- Work with CAD to develop print and raw material artwork, considering printability and technical limitations.
- Use NED Graphics to recolor print artwork and pitch colorways for novelty raw materials.
- Create and maintain print presentation boards in Illustrator/Indesign and communicate color and print POV to cross-functional teams.
- Collaborate with Print Technologists and Raw Materials teams to develop and execute print/novelty raw materials within technical limitations.
- Review print and novelty raw material strike-offs for layout and execution.
- Track color and print deliverables using the design calendar, ensuring alignment with key milestone meetings.
